Titanium CNC Machining Services

Titanium is a lightweight, high-strength metal with excellent corrosion resistance and biocompatibility. It is available in pure grades and stronger alloyed forms, making it suitable for both general and high-performance applications. Even pure titanium contains trace elements of oxygen and iron, while alloys are engineered to provide enhanced durability and strength.

With its unique strength-to-weight ratio and ability to withstand extreme environments, titanium is widely used in aerospace, medical, energy, and chemical processing industries. CNC machining ensures precise, reliable production of titanium parts, from prototypes to complex components. 

Titanium CNC Machining Machining Applications

  • Aerospace: Structural parts, turbine blades, and engine components requiring high strength-to-weight ratios and heat resistance.
  • Medical: Surgical instruments, orthopedic implants, and dental devices where biocompatibility is critical.

  • Energy: Components for offshore drilling, power generation, and renewable energy systems exposed to extreme environments.

  • Chemical Processing: Pumps, valves, and heat exchangers resistant to corrosion and aggressive chemicals.

  • Automotive & Motorsport: Lightweight performance parts to improve fuel efficiency and durability under stress.

With CNC machining, titanium parts can be produced with tight tolerances and complex geometries, enabling industries to fully leverage the material’s advantages.
